Table 2.
Additional annotation and gene expression data for 19 prioritized biomarker candidate proteins
Protein ID | Protein functional annotation | Protein length (AA) | Predicted secretion | Gene exp. Level (avg. adult female FPKM) | Gene expression consistency (% of adult females) | Missense + nonsense SNP rate (Choi et al, 2016) |
---|---|---|---|---|---|---|
OVOC11613 | Major antigen/lfi-1 - Lin-5 (Five) Interacting | 2021 | − | 17.0 | 100% | 3.6 |
OVOC1523 | ATP synthase subunit alpha, mitochondrial | 535 | − | 1963.9 | 100% | 1.2 |
OVOC247 | Ovo-lam-3 - Laminin alpha chain | 3358 | Signal peptide | 24.9 | 100% | 2.7 |
OVOC11626 | Inactive serine/threonine-protein kinase PLK5 | 268 | Nonclassical | 2.0 | 100% | 11.2 |
OVOC9912 | IPR003609:PAN/Apple domain | 628 | Signal peptide | 0.3 | 87.5% | 15.4 |
OVOC4989 | Ovo-unc-22 - Twitchin homolog | 6785 | − | 28.9 | 100% | 2.3 |
OVOC10067 | Basement membrane proteoglycan | 3415 | Signal peptide | 0.9 | 100% | 7.1 |
OVOC2745 | Actin-4 | 376 | − | 359.1 | 100% | 0.9 |
OVOC7004 | Putative cubilin | 4112 | Signal peptide | 0.0 | 12.5% | 22.0 |
OVOC7893 | H2B: histone H2B | 380 | − | 72.2 | 100% | 2.6 |
OVOC10971 | Ovo-phb-2 - Mitochondrial prohibitin complex protein 2 | 568 | − | 275.7 | 100% | 4.1 |
OVOC1599 | Ovo-adpr-1 - WDTC1, WD and tetratricopeptide repeats | 597 | − | 21.8 | 100% | 0.6 |
OVOC7471 | Ovo-magu-2 - MAGUK p55 subfamily member 5 | 861 | − | 0.6 | 100% | 8.1 |
OVOC216 | still life protein homolog | 987 | − | 12.8 | 100% | 1.7 |
OVOC1112 | Ovo-smg-1 - Serine/threonine-protein kinase smg-1 | 2527 | − | 13.8 | 100% | 3.8 |
OVOC3364 | (Filarial-specific) | 166 | Signal peptide | 0.0 | 38% | 12.5 |
OVOC874 | (Nematode-specific) | 239 | − | 106.1 | 100.0% | 0.0 |
OVOC8003 | Ovo-lgc-50 - Ligand-gated ion channel 50 homolog | 221 | − | 0.1 | 63% | 8.7 |
OVOC9445 | PPP1C: serine/threonine phosphatase PP1 catalytic | 671 | − | 9.8 | 100.0% | 0.0 |
Included are the protein lengths (amino acids), predicted secretion, gene expression in adult females (RNA-seq), gene expression consistency among adult females, and the rate of missense + nonsense single nucleotide polymorphisms (SNPs) per kilobase of protein sequence, based on results from Choi et al, 2016 (46).
Abbreviation: FPKM, fragments per kilobase per million reads.
